Olanzapine 2.5 mg Oral Tablet
C 45: Olanzapine 2.5 mg Oral Tablet
NDC: *
52343-038
Imprint:
C 45
Color:
Yellow
Shape:
Round
Size:
5 mm
Segments:
1
Drug:
Olanzapine
Labeler: *
Gen-source Rx
Category:
Antipsychotic
* May have multiple labelers & NDC codes.
Source: US National Library of Medicine (NLM)

Round blue pill with Pliva 456 on it, please tell me what this is? ## This tablet contains Oxybutynin Chloride 5 mg (NDC 50111-0456), which is an anticholinergic medication used to relieve urinary and bladder difficulties, including frequent urination and inability to control urination (urge incontinence), by decreasing muscle spasms of the bladder. Inactive Ingredients: - Calcium Stearate - Cellulose, Microcrystalline - Anhydrous Lactose - Sodium Starch Glycolate Type a Potato - Fd&c Blue No. 1 - Aluminum Oxide Ref: DailyMed ## its really fast
